What are ETFs and why are they important? ETFs, or Exchange Traded Funds, are investment vehicles that track the performance of a specific asset or group of assets, such as stocks, commodities, or in this case, cryptocurrencies. These funds allow investors to gain exposure to the crypto market without directly owning the underlying assets, making it an attractive option for those looking to diversify their portfolio and manage risk.
